A high-pressure single-crystal x-ray diffraction study of perovskite-type MgSiO 3 has been completed to 12.6 GPa. The compressibility of MgSiO 3 perovskite is anisotropic with b approximately 23% less compressible than a or c which have similar compressibilities. The observed unit cell compression g
